搜索 社区服务 统计排行 帮助
  • 9810阅读
  • 69回复

[请教]如何用crf来做2pass的1th pass

楼层直达
级别: 新手上路
注册时间:
2006-04-16
在线时间:
0小时
发帖:
286
只看该作者 15楼 发表于: 2009-04-15
引用
最初由 雷鸣 发布


我的gui支持。但是不支持新版的x264

你是来推销的:p
级别: 新手上路
注册时间:
2006-04-16
在线时间:
0小时
发帖:
286
只看该作者 16楼 发表于: 2009-04-15
引用
最初由 roozhou 发布
现在没有GUI支持crf+bitrate的2pass,自己写个bat比什么都方便

bat里面应该怎么写,能给个具体的例子吗,本人对dos不是很熟,谢谢啦
级别: 新手上路
注册时间:
2009-03-08
在线时间:
0小时
发帖:
27
只看该作者 17楼 发表于: 2009-04-15
你其他参数高了吧 我也是b-adapt2 b帧为6 FPS:1PASS是2PASS的3到4倍
级别: 新手上路
注册时间:
2006-04-16
在线时间:
0小时
发帖:
286
只看该作者 18楼 发表于: 2009-04-15
引用
最初由 yeyunlong 发布
你其他参数高了吧 我也是b-adapt2 b帧为6 FPS:1PASS是2PASS的3到4倍

速度也就不说了,主要是cpu不能占满
级别: 精灵王
注册时间:
2008-04-08
在线时间:
44小时
发帖:
2855
只看该作者 19楼 发表于: 2009-04-15
占不满的主要原因就是b-adapt 2 + b6太慢了,如果你用b3或者b-adapt 1就能占满了。还有一种办法是不要用turbo,把subme调高,merange调大。

还有2nd pass时要应该用b-adapt 0

P.S. 想要CPU占满很容易,电脑上多放几个病毒保证你任何时候CPU都是满的
级别: 新手上路
注册时间:
2006-04-16
在线时间:
0小时
发帖:
286
只看该作者 20楼 发表于: 2009-04-15
引用
最初由 roozhou 发布
占不满的主要原因就是b-adapt 2 + b6太慢了,如果你用b3或者b-adapt 1就能占满了。还有一种办法是不要用turbo,把subme调高,merange调大。

还有2nd pass时要应该用b-adapt 0

P.S. 想要CPU占满很容易,电脑上多放几个病毒保证你任何时候CPU都是满的

能帮忙写个1th pass的bat吗,最好能输出压制结果log的,就要里面的内容就可以了,拜托了
级别: 精灵王
注册时间:
2008-04-08
在线时间:
44小时
发帖:
2855
只看该作者 21楼 发表于: 2009-04-15
x264.exe %1 --crf 20 --pass 1 --stats %2 -r1 -b3 --b-adapt 2 -m1 --me dia -t1 -o NUL --no-ssim --no-psnr --progress --threads 4

其中%1是输入文件名,%2是log文件名,其他参数像aq之类可以自己再加
级别: 新手上路
注册时间:
2006-04-16
在线时间:
0小时
发帖:
286
只看该作者 22楼 发表于: 2009-04-15
引用
最初由 roozhou 发布
x264.exe %1 --crf 20 --pass 1 --stats %2 -r1 -b3 --b-adapt 2 -m1 --me dia -t1 -o NUL --no-ssim --no-psnr --progress --threads 4

其中%1是输入文件名,%2是log文件名,其他参数像aq之类可以自己再加

谢谢,再问一下在megui里2nd pass时如何导入stats文件
级别: 新手上路
注册时间:
2006-04-16
在线时间:
0小时
发帖:
286
只看该作者 23楼 发表于: 2009-04-15
试了一下,只生成了一个叫-r1的没有文件名的stats,没有生成log
级别: 工作组
注册时间:
2005-05-03
在线时间:
0小时
发帖:
2914
只看该作者 24楼 发表于: 2009-04-15
x264.exe %1 --crf 20 --pass 1 --stats "%~n1.log" -r1 -b3 --b-adapt 2 -m1 --me dia -t1 -o NUL --no-ssim --no-psnr --progress --threads 0

试试看这样
级别: 精灵王
注册时间:
2008-04-08
在线时间:
44小时
发帖:
2855
只看该作者 25楼 发表于: 2009-04-15
楼主你到底会不会用bat啊
级别: 新手上路
注册时间:
2006-04-16
在线时间:
0小时
发帖:
286
只看该作者 26楼 发表于: 2009-04-15
引用
最初由 雷鸣 发布
x264.exe %1 --crf 20 --pass 1 --stats "%~n1.log" -r1 -b3 --b-adapt 2 -m1 --me dia -t1 -o NUL --no-ssim --no-psnr --progress --threads 0

试试看这样
类似megui里的log,可以看到qp及最终码率的那种
级别: 新手上路
注册时间:
2006-04-16
在线时间:
0小时
发帖:
286
只看该作者 27楼 发表于: 2009-04-15
引用
最初由 roozhou 发布
楼主你到底会不会用bat啊

你给我的可以用,就是不能输出log,就是能看最终qp值的那种
级别: 新手上路
注册时间:
2006-04-16
在线时间:
0小时
发帖:
286
只看该作者 28楼 发表于: 2009-04-15
要在megui里在2nd pass时导入stats,是否只要和avs同名就可以了?
级别: 工作组
注册时间:
2005-05-03
在线时间:
0小时
发帖:
2914
只看该作者 29楼 发表于: 2009-04-15
引用
最初由 zjhray 发布
类似megui里的log,可以看到qp及最终码率的那种


这不是编码输出啊……我觉得应该是一些只有x264自己看得懂的东西写在里面才对

第二pass的时候,megui主界面上面config按钮按了以后弹出的窗口里面可以看到 logfile 这个框框, 选择生成的log就好。log文件按理来说会和avs放在一起
快速回复

限150 字节
上一个 下一个